Bengaluru Metro Disruption Raises Urban Transit Safety Questions
Bengaluru Metro services faced disruption after an incident at Cubbon Park station affected operations, highlighting the growing importance of passenger safety, security systems, and operational resilience in the city’s expanding public transport network. The episode comes as Bengaluru increasingly relies on metro connectivity to manage congestion and provide a cleaner alternative to road-based travel.
The disruption affected commuters using one of the city’s busiest transit corridors, drawing attention to how even isolated incidents can impact thousands of daily passengers in a rapidly growing urban system. As metro ridership continues to rise, maintaining smooth operations has become essential for Bengaluru’s mobility planning.Public transport experts note that metro systems require strong safety protocols, quick response mechanisms, and effective communication strategies to minimise inconvenience during unexpected events.Passenger behaviour, security checks, and emergency preparedness all play an important role in ensuring reliable services.Bengaluru’s metro network has become a critical part of the city’s transport infrastructure, helping reduce dependence on private vehicles and supporting lower-emission mobility. However, as the network expands, operational challenges also increase, requiring stronger systems for crowd management, safety monitoring, and passenger awareness.
A senior urban mobility expert said that reliability is a key factor in encouraging more citizens to shift towards public transport.Frequent disruptions, even when resolved quickly, can influence commuter confidence and highlight the need for continuous improvements in transit management.The incident also reflects a broader challenge faced by growing cities.Large-scale public infrastructure must be designed not only for capacity expansion but also for everyday safety and resilience.This includes investing in technology, trained personnel, and clear response procedures.For Bengaluru, strengthening metro reliability has wider environmental and economic significance. A dependable public transport system can reduce road congestion, lower emissions, improve access to employment centres, and support more sustainable urban growth.Experts suggest that as metro services become increasingly central to city life, safety measures must evolve alongside expansion plans. Better passenger education, improved monitoring systems, and efficient crisis management can help maintain trust in public mobility networks.
The future of Bengaluru’s transport landscape will depend not only on building more metro lines but also on ensuring that existing systems remain safe, efficient, and resilient.Reliable public transport will be a key foundation for creating a more connected and climate-friendly city.
